One cup of Scrambled egg sandwich with spinach is around 236.6 grams and contains approximately 473.2 calories, 23.7 grams of protein, 18.9 grams of fat, and 47.3 grams of carbohydrates.
Scrambled Egg Sandwich With Spinach is a delightful and nutritious breakfast option that brings together fluffy scrambled eggs, fresh spinach, and hearty whole-grain bread. Originating from classic brunch menus, this sandwich combines protein-packed eggs with the vibrant green benefits of spinach, rich in vitamins and minerals. It's a perfect balance of creamy and savory flavors, making it satisfying and delicious. Not only is it quick to prepare, but it also provides essential nutrients while being low in calories.
